In recent years, Arkaduisz Milik has come close to signing for Juventus on more than one occasion. For one reason or another, the move had never materialized until last summer when the Pole made an initial switch on loan from Olympique Marseille.

However, the delay was surely not due to the player’s desire, as he was apparently hell-bent on joining the Bianconeri a long time ago.

Former Juventus striker Fernando Llorente revealed that Milik had dreamed of playing for the Turin giants since their days together at Napoli.

The experienced Spaniard joined the Partenopei in the summer of 2019, acting as a substitute for the Polish striker.

A year later, both players were out after the arrival of Victor Osimhen. Back then, Milik hoped to secure a move to Turin, while Llorente’s advice only strengthened his desire.

“I’m not surprised by Milik’s transfer to Juventus, because he was already talking about it when we were together at Napoli,” the 37-year-old revealed in an interview with La Gazzetta dello Sport via Ilbianconero.

“Arek already dreamed of the black and white shirt. During the period when Milik and I were training alone, he asked me for advice.

“I told him that Juventus is a crazy club and that he has to leave if they call him. I’m glad to see him happy and fit.

“The bianconeri returned his smile and it is paying off with goals. Arek is a complete striker. He has a strong head, a great left foot and he knows how to play football”. concluded the former Athletic Bilbao attacker.
